Transaction d41c4a04e740b2a339902d90fd9e9d73121627eba1ea77261176b3d28255c026
1 Input
1 Output
-
d41c4a04e740b2a339902d90fd9e9d73121627eba1ea77261176b3d28255c026:0
- value
- 503423
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ed21eef23ea390b02bf5f3f77134f8cd4d95d09a
- address
- bc1qa5s7au375wgtq2l470mhzd8ce4xet5y6sp2tdy